FlixBus

About
FlixBus is one of Europe’s leading low-cost bus companies, founded in Germany and now offering long-distance services across Europe and the United States. In addition to its extensive daytime network, FlixBus also operates overnight buses on select European routes. Standard amenities include free Wi-Fi, power outlets to charge devices, extra legroom, luggage space, and onboard toilets, with snacks and drinks available for purchase. FlixBus offers a single Standard ticket type for all routes, which includes one carry-on bag and one checked bag per passenger. Additional fees apply for extra luggage and for reserving specific seats, such as Extra Seats, Table Seats, or Panorama Seats. This combination of affordability, comfort, and wide coverage makes FlixBus a popular choice for budget-conscious travelers.

National Express

About
National Express is the UK’s leading long-distance coach company, operating over 550 services per day and serving more than 900 destinations nationwide. It also runs frequent services to major UK airports — including Heathrow, Gatwick, Stansted, Luton, and Bristol — 24 hours a day. All National Express coaches are air-conditioned and offer free Wi-Fi and onboard entertainment. Most vehicles are equipped with seat belts and power outlets at every seat, allowing you to charge your phone or laptop during your journey. Ticket options include Restricted Fare, Standard Fare, and Fully Flexible Fare, with the latter providing maximum flexibility for cancellations or changes.

Complete guide to Cheltenham

Things to do in Cheltenham

Discover the best of Cheltenham — top attractions, local food, transport tips, budget advice, and currency essentials. Plan your perfect Cheltenham trip today.

  • Must visit

The Wilson Art Gallery and Museum

Cheltenham's main museum and art gallery, with local history, archaeology, and decorative arts. A top place to understand the town and region.

  • Recommended

The Soldiers of Gloucestershire Museum

Specialist military museum in the former county jail, telling the story of the Gloucestershire Regiment through medals, uniforms, and campaigns.

Railway Museum at Cheltenham Racecourse

Volunteer-run railway museum at Cheltenham Racecourse, featuring locomotives, heritage carriages, and displays on the Gloucestershire Warwickshire Railway.

British Pound Sterling (£)

Moderate for the UK: hotels and dining are mid-priced, buses are reasonable, and costs are usually lower than London but higher than smaller towns.

Average meal costs

Budget
£8-15 for fast food or a simple meal.
Mid-range
£18-35 per person for a restaurant meal.
Fine dining
£60+ per person for upscale dining.
Coffee
£3-4.50 for a cappuccino.

Tipping culture

Service may be included. If not, tip 10-12.5% at restaurants for good service. Taxis are often rounded up or tipped about 10%. Cafes usually do not require tipping.

The currency used in the United Kingdom is the British Pound Sterling (GBP). For travelers, using a card is generally more convenient and widely accepted, especially in cities and for transportation tickets, though carrying some cash can be useful for small purchases or in rural areas.
In Cheltenham, travelers should be cautious of pickpocketing, especially during busy events like the Cheltenham Festival. Common scams include overcharging by unofficial taxi drivers and fake charity collectors. It’s advisable to use licensed transportation and stay vigilant in crowded areas.
